About The Position

SANCORP is seeking a Quality Manager to support Operational and Technical Support services for the National Integrated Ballistic Information Network (NIBIN) for the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ms, and Explosives (ATF). The Quality Manager will support the NNCTC I, II, and other NIBIN sites. Responsible for the coordination and administration of activities required to implement and maintain quality throughout the centers, including compliance with specific International Standards. Report to the Program Manager or their designee as approved by the COR. Provide technical guidance for government and technical direction for the contract staff members at the NNCTCs in functions related to accreditation, certification, and quality assurance/control. Work with onsite government and contract staff at the NNCTCs to ensure compliance with the Minimum Required Operating Standards for NIBIN Sites (MROS), International Organization for Standardization (ISO)/International Electrotechnical Commission (IEC) 17020, and current American National Standards Institute (ANSI) National Accreditation Board (ANAB) Accreditation Requirements or other accreditation board requirements. Work with onsite government and contract staff at the NNCTCs to monitor and review all program practices that affect the quality of triage, acquisition, and correlation review results on a continuous basis. Schedule, monitor and/or conduct audits of center’s practices, verify compliance with policies and procedures through annual assessments, proficiency testing, corrective action review and other procedures and documentation Assist government staff with creating and writing various documents for the quality management system. Assist the government staff with planning, creating, and implementing various programs for the quality management system. Train and mentor contractor Quality Personnel to develop quality assurance and quality control skills, including understanding compliance with specific International Standards and the customer’s MROS. Requirements

  • Bachelor’s Degree from an accredited college or university, or possession of a combination of formal education and professional work experience related to this position.
  • Minimum of five years’ experience as a Quality Assurance Technician or Quality Manager.
  • 40+ hours of audit training with MROS and/or International Standards.
  • Experience with International Standards and/or regulatory bodies.
  • Active TS/SCI Security Clearance.
  • Must be a U.S. Citizen.
